Winning is always nice, but doing so behind a season-high score is even better (just ask Texas Alliance of Christian Athletes). They walked away with a 78-67 win over the Parker-Tarrant HomeSchool Warriors on Thursday. The victory was all the more spectacular given the Storm's disadvantage in MaxPreps' Texas basketball rankings (they are ranked 226th, while the Warriors are ranked 112th).
Parker-Tarrant HomeSchool's loss came despite strong showings from Toby Pike and Timothy Jones. Pike dropped a double-double on 20 points and ten rebounds, while Jones went 6 of 12 on his way to 18 points. Pike's evening made it seven games in a row in which he has scored at least ten points. The team also got some help courtesy of Levi Symes, who posted six points.
Texas Alliance of Christian Athletes' win bumped their record up to 8-5. As for Parker-Tarrant HomeSchool, their loss dropped their record down to 16-4.
Texas Alliance of Christian Athletes will get to enjoy the win for a while: their next game is against First Baptist at 2:00 p.m. on December 31st. As for Parker-Tarrant HomeSchool, they will be taking part in a tournament against Nolan Catholic at 12:00 p.m. on December 27th.
